Who am I?
My name is Ruth Hussey and I am the Chair of the 17³Ô¹ÏÍø, National Advisory Board.
What do I do?
I am the Deputy Chair of the Food Standards Agency, and a contributor to policy and research advisory boards as well as a trustee of The Health Foundation and The Reader charity. I led the Parliamentary Review of Health and Social Care in Wales, which was published in 2018, and was delighted to be appointed as Chair of the 17³Ô¹ÏÍø National Advisory Board in January 2020.
